Greytown (now known as South End) was once a small shipping port actively linking land and sea In the late 1860's Franz Bevilaqua (a resident of Greytown) decided there needed to be a better road between Millicent and Greytown He was the main instigator in building a ford on the old Greytown road through a section of boggy teatree south of Lake Frome The crossing included a drain and a bridge, which was built at a later date The 1st train engine to arrive in Millicent... once off loaded from the boat at Greytown... travelled this route by bullock wagon Today it is still known as Bevilaqua Ford and is one of the main access points to the Canunda National Park What a shame the old wooden bridge of our childhood days is no longer standing....!!!!
